How to read this

Firms are grouped into tiers, not ranked one to fifteen. A tier holds every firm whose 95% confidence interval overlaps the leader's, which is a long way of saying the sample cannot tell them apart. Order within a tier is arbitrary — read the counts, not the position.

Share is the percentage of responses that named the firm — not a quality score. A firm scoring low here may be excellent and simply under-written about online, which is a finding about its visibility rather than its work.

The same question was asked repeatedly because AI assistants do not answer identically twice. A single response would tell you almost nothing.

What this measurement does not tell you

  • It is not a quality ranking. Share reflects how much has been written about a firm online, which is what an AI assistant reads. A capable firm nobody writes about scores low here.
  • It is a reading from a date range, not a permanent standing. This sample was collected August 8, 2026–August 19, 2026; models change and so do their answers.
  • It covers ChatGPT only. Other assistants answer differently, and we do not extrapolate across engines we have not measured.
  • Order within a tier is arbitrary. Read the counts, not the position. Why we use tiers.
